Yes, according to her marriage entry as per above, Mary was the daughter of Thomas WETHERALL whose occupation is given as Pensioner .  This ties in with a Thomas WITHEROW or WEATHERALL born Banagher, Londonderry who served in the 37th Foot Regiment and 4th Royal Battalion.  Presumably he returned home to Banagher after his discharge. His occupation was also given as weaver and plaisterer on other documents.

The Griffiths Valuation has one entry for a Mary WITHEROW living at Irish Green but it is dated 1858.

I'm trying to trace a Withrow ancestor who left northern Ireland around 1718-1720.  We have a bible record for a Robert and Jennet Withrow, who were the ancestors of a goodly number of Withrows now living in the USA.  But as far as I know, no one has been able to connect our group with a family in Ireland or the Withrows around Glasgow, Scotland.  Any help or pointers would be appreciated.
